Abstract

The video rate processor ( 10 ) is made up of an Input Video Stream input ( 11 ), at least one Input Processor/Input Devices ( 12 ), at least one Most Recent Frame Buffer ( 14 ), and at least one Output Processes/Output Device ( 16 ). The video rate processor ( 10 ) is dynamically tuned to the specific requirements of a user and the capabilities of the user's device. Further, the video rate processor ( 10 ) enables to receipt of video images in real time or from archived files while substantially maintaining the integrity of the video information.

Claims (41)

1. A method for the video control of at least one information unit stream, the method comprising the steps of:

storing an at least one information unit stream at a low video frame rate into a first storage area;

storing the at least one information unit stream at a high video frame rate into a second storage area;

selectively outputting the at least one information unit stream stored in the first storage area and in the second storage area; and

controlling the application of an input handling entity and an output handling entity to the at least one information unit stream stored in the first storage area and the at least one information unit stream stored in the second storage area consequent to the occurrence of an at least one event.

2. The method of claim 1 further comprising the step of outputting an at least one information unit stream having a controlled specific unit rate by the at least one output handling entity to an at least one information unit stream display device via a communication media.

3. The method as claimed in claim 1 wherein the unit rate of the at least one outputted information unit stream generated by the at least one output handling entity is controlled by an in-built timing mechanism associated with the at least one output handling entity.

4. The method as claimed in claim 1 wherein the unit rate of the at least one outputted information unit streams is further controlled by the pre-defined characteristics of the at least one output handling entity.

5. The method as claimed in claim 1 wherein the unit rate of the at least one outputted information unit streams is further controlled by a pre-defined characteristic of the communication media.

6. The method as claimed in claim 1 wherein the at least one information unit stream is a digital information stream.

7. The method as claimed in claim 1 wherein the occurrence of the at least one event is detected automatically.

8. The method as claimed in claim 1 further comprising the step of continuously deleting the at least one information unit stream stored in the second storage area.

9. The method as claimed in claim 8 further comprising the step of stopping the deletion of the at least one information unit stream stored in the second storage area if an event has occurred.

10. The method as claimed in claim 1 wherein the method is used in a surveillance system, for adapting the unit rates to available resources.
